﻿/* -------------------------------  */
/* ADAPTACION ESTILOS UI DE JQUERY  */
/* -------------------------------  */

/* Botones */

.TipoBoton:hover
{
	/*border: 1px solid #79b7e7;
	background: #d0e5f5 url(redmond/images/ui-bg_glass_75_d0e5f5_1x400.png) 50% 50% repeat-x;
	font-weight: bold;
	color: #1d5987;*/
	background-color:#575757 !important; 
}

.TipoBoton:active
{
	/*border: 1px solid #79b7e7;
	background: #f5f8f9 url(redmond/images/ui-bg_inset-hard_100_f5f8f9_1x100.png) 50% 50% repeat-x;
	font-weight: bold;
	color: #e17009;*/
	background-color:#575757 !important; 
}

.TipoBoton 
{
    background-color:#00babc !important; 
    color:#fff !important; 
    padding:3px 10px 3px 10px !important; 
    cursor:pointer !important;
    background-image:none !important;
    border:1px solid #4ac5c8 !important;
    font-family: 'swis721' !important;
    font-weight: normal !important;
    font-size:15px !important;
}

.TipoBotonInv 
{
    background-color:#575757 !important; 
    color:#fff !important; 
    padding:3px 10px 3px 10px !important; 
    cursor:pointer !important;
    background-image:none !important;
    border:1px solid #575757 !important;
    font-family: 'swis721' !important;
    font-weight: normal !important;
    font-size:15px !important;
}

.TipoBotonInv:hover
{
	background-color:#b4b5b5 !important; 
	border:1px solid #b4b5b5 !important;
}

.TipoBotonInv:active
{
	background-color:#b4b5b5 !important; 
	border:1px solid #b4b5b5 !important;
}


.TipoBotonEliminar:hover
{
	/*border: 1px solid #79b7e7;
	background: #d0e5f5 url(redmond/images/ui-bg_glass_75_d0e5f5_1x400.png) 50% 50% repeat-x;
	font-weight: bold;
	color: #1d5987;*/
	background-color:#575757 !important; 
}

.TipoBotonEliminar:active
{
	/*border: 1px solid #79b7e7;
	background: #f5f8f9 url(redmond/images/ui-bg_inset-hard_100_f5f8f9_1x100.png) 50% 50% repeat-x;
	font-weight: bold;
	color: #e17009;*/
	background-color:#575757 !important; 
}

.TipoBotonEliminar 
{
    margin-top: -2px;
    background-color:#00babc !important; 
    color:#fff !important; 
    padding:1px 10px 3px 10px !important; 
    cursor:pointer !important;
    background-image:none !important;
    border:1px solid #4ac5c8 !important;
    font-family: 'swis721' !important;
    font-weight: normal !important;
    font-size:13px !important;
}



.TipoCerrar:hover
{
    border: 1px solid #79b7e7;
	background: #d0e5f5 url(images/ui-bg_glass_75_d0e5f5_1x400.png) 50% 50% repeat-x;
	font-weight: bold;
	color: #1d5987;
}

/* Ajax ToolKit Tab control */

.TipoTab 
{
}

.TipoTab .ajax__tab_container
{
    color:Black;
}
.TipoTab .ajax__tab_outer .ajax__tab_inner .ajax__tab_tab 
{
    margin-right:0;
}
.TipoTab .ajax__tab_header 
{
    /*font-family:verdana,tahoma,helvetica;
    font-size:11px;
    background:url(Tabs/tab-line.gif) repeat-x bottom;  */
    background: url("redmond/images/ui-bg_gloss-wave_55_5c9ccc_500x100.png") repeat-x scroll 50% 50% #5C9CCC; 
    border: 1px solid #00bdbf;
    color: #FFFFFF;
    /*font-weight: bold;*/
    border-top-right-radius: 5px;
    border-top-left-radius: 5px;
    padding: 0.2em 0.2em 0;
    margin: 0;
    line-height:100%;
    font-family:'swis721c',Tahoma,Arial !important;
}

.TipoTab .ajax__tab_outer 
{
    padding-right:4px;
    background:url(Tabs/tab-right.gif) no-repeat right;
    /* height:3em; */
}
.TipoTab .ajax__tab_inner 
{
    padding-left:3px;
    background:url(Tabs/tab-left.gif) no-repeat;
}
.TipoTab .ajax__tab_tab 
{
    /* height:13px;
    padding:4px;
    margin:0;
    background:url(Tabs/tab.gif) repeat-x; */
    cursor: pointer;
    background-color: #ffffff;
    float: left;
    padding: 0.5em 1em;
    text-decoration: none;
    font-weight:bold;
    border: 1px solid #fffff;
    color: #a5e2e3;
    /*background: url("redmond/images/ui-bg_glass_85_dfeffc_1x400.png") repeat-x scroll 50% 50% #DFEFFC;*/
    border-top-right-radius: 5px;
    border-top-left-radius: 5px;
}
.TipoTab .ajax__tab_hover .ajax__tab_outer 
{
    /* background:url(Tabs/tab-hover-right.gif) no-repeat right; */
}
.TipoTab .ajax__tab_hover .ajax__tab_inner 
{
   /*  background:url(Tabs/tab-hover-left.gif) no-repeat; */
}
.TipoTab .ajax__tab_hover .ajax__tab_tab 
{
   /* background:url(Tabs/tab-hover.gif) repeat-x; */
	/*border: 1px solid #79b7e7;*/
	/*background: #d0e5f5 url(redmond/images/ui-bg_glass_75_d0e5f5_1x400.png) 50% 50% repeat-x;*/
	/*font-weight: bold;*/
	color: #00bdbf;
}
.TipoTab .ajax__tab_active .ajax__tab_outer 
{
   /*background:url(Tabs/tab-active-right.gif) no-repeat right; 	
	background: #d0e5f5 url(redmond/images/ui-bg_glass_75_d0e5f5_1x400.png) 50% 50% repeat-x;   */
}
.TipoTab .ajax__tab_active .ajax__tab_inner 
{
   /* background:url(Tabs/tab-active-left.gif) no-repeat; */
   
}
.TipoTab .ajax__tab_active .ajax__tab_tab 
{
    /*  background:url(Tabs/tab-active.gif) repeat-x; padding-bottom: 1px;  */
    color: #00bdbf;
    background-image:none;
    background-color:#fff;
    margin-bottom: -3px;
    border-bottom-color: White;
    border-bottom-width: 3px;
}

.TipoTab .ajax__tab_body 
{
    font-family:verdana,tahoma,helvetica;
    font-size:10pt;
    border:0px solid #999999;
    border-top:0;
    padding:8px;
    background-color:#fff;
    border-bottom-right-radius: 5px;
    border-bottom-left-radius: 5px;
    min-height:588px;    
}

.TipoRedondeo2 /* se usa para el div contenedor de los Tabs */
{    
    border-bottom-right-radius: 5px;
    border-bottom-left-radius: 5px;
    border-top-right-radius: 5px;
    border-top-left-radius: 5px;
    border-color: #a5e2e3 !important;
    font-family:'swis721c',Tahoma,Arial !important;
    border-width: 1px 1px 0px 1px !important;
}

.TipoRedondeo /* se usa para el div contenedor de los Tabs */
{    
    border-bottom-right-radius: 5px;
    border-bottom-left-radius: 5px;
    border-top-right-radius: 5px;
    border-top-left-radius: 5px;
    border-color: #a5e2e3 !important;
    font-family:'swis721c',Tahoma,Arial !important;
}
/* TEXTBOX */
 .TipoTextbox 
  {
      background-image:none !important;
      background-color:#b4b5b5 !important;
      cursor:text;
      text-align:left;
      color:#fff;
      font-family: 'swis721';
      font-size:15px;
      font-weight:normal;
      margin:0px 0px 5px 0px; 
      padding:2px 10px 2px 10px !important;
      line-height: 20px !important;
  }
  
  .TipoTextboxBuscar
  {
      background-image:none !important;
      /*ackground-color:#b4b5b5 !important;*/
      cursor:text;
      text-align:left;
      font-family: 'swis721';
      font-size:15px;
      font-weight:normal;
      margin:0px 0px 5px 0px; 
      padding:2px 10px 2px 10px !important;
      line-height: 20px !important;
      color: #00bdbf;
  }
  
   .TipoTextboxWater
  {
      background-image:none !important;
      background-color:white !important;
      font-size:1em;
      cursor:text;
      text-align:left;
      font-style:italic;
      font-weight:lighter !important;
      font-family:'swis721',Tahoma,Arial !important;
      color: #00bdbf;
  }  

/* LABEL */

 .TipoLabel 
  {
      background-image:none !important;
      background-color:transparent !important;
      cursor:text;
      text-align:left;
      border: none !important;
     /* line-height:300%; */
      font-family: 'swis721c';
      font-size:17px;  
      color: #575757;   
      font-weight:normal;
  }
  
/* TIPO ACORDEON */

 .TipoAcordeon 
  {
      padding-left:20px;  
      cursor:pointer;
      line-height:200%;
      font-family:'swis721',Tahoma,Arial !important;    
  }
 
 .TipoAcordeon2
  {
      padding-left:20px;
      padding-top:6px;  
      cursor:pointer;
      line-height:150%;
      font-family:'swis721',Tahoma,Arial !important;    
  }
 /* TIPO Radio Buttom */
 .TipoRadio
 {
     font-size:0.8em;
     font-family:'swis721c',Tahoma,Arial !important;
 }
 
 /* TIPO AUTOCOMPLETE  */ 
 
  .autocomplete_completionListElement
{
    font-family:'swis721c',Tahoma,Arial !important;
    list-style: none;
	padding: 5px 0px 0px 0px;
	margin-left:-1px;
	margin-top: -3px;
	display: block;
	outline: none;
	border-width: 1px;
	border-style: solid;
	border-color: #00bdbf;
	height: 395px;
	overflow : auto;
	cursor: pointer;
	line-height:25px;
	background-color:White;
	left:-1500px;
	top:-1500px;
	z-index:99999999999999 !important;
}

.autocomplete_completionListItem
{
    padding-left: 10px;
    color:#1d5987;
}

.autocomplete_completionListItemHigh
{
    padding-left: 10px;
    /*background: #d0e5f5 url(redmond/images/ui-bg_glass_75_d0e5f5_1x400.png) 50% 50% repeat-x;*/
    background-color:#00bdbf;
    border: 1px solid #00bdbf;
    color:#ffffff;
    font-weight:normal;
}


.cssTooltip
{
    z-index:999999999999;   
}

/* ----------------------------------------------------------------------------------------*/

/* VENTANA MODAL  */
.modalWindow
{
    /*position:absolute;
    z-index:999999992 !important;*/
}

.ModalBackground /* Fondo que provoca la ventana modal */
{
    background-color:#04619c;
    filter:alpha(opacity=50);
    opacity:0.5;
    z-index:999999991 !important;
}


/* VENTANA MODAL 2ª nivel  */
.modalWindow2
{
    position:absolute;
    z-index:999999999 !important;
}

.ModalBackground2 /* Fondo que provoca la ventana modal */
{
    background-color:#04619c;
    filter:alpha(opacity=50);
    opacity:0.5;
    z-index:999999998 !important;
}